The Armed Society And Its Friends: A Reckoning, Charles W. Collier
The Armed Society And Its Friends: A Reckoning, Charles W. Collier
UF Law Faculty Publications
This Article provides a selective introduction to some of the main social, cultural, historical, and intellectual issues surrounding gun violence and the desultory policy “debates” over gun control in America.
Unregulated gun violence, unrestricted gun violence, unlimited gun violence: these are the grave “new normal” (a term coined in financial economics) on the otherwise pastoral landscape of America. Sociologically speaking, this level of gun violence is no longer considered deviant, such that “special sanctions” would be imposed to prevent it.
